Light booms refer to a type of equipment or structure that is used to support lighting fixtures, often in theatrical or event settings. | 灯光吊杆指的是一种用于支撑灯具的设备或结构,通常用于戏剧或活动场合。 |

In the world of photography and videography, the importance of lighting cannot be overstated. One of the most fascinating aspects of lighting is the phenomenon known as light booms. A light boom refers to a device that allows photographers and filmmakers to position lights at various angles and heights, thus creating dynamic and captivating visuals. This tool has revolutionized the way we think about lighting in our projects.The concept of light booms is not just about the physical equipment; it also encompasses the creative possibilities that arise from their use. For instance, by adjusting the height and angle of the lights, one can create dramatic shadows or highlight specific features of a subject. This flexibility is essential for achieving the desired mood and tone in both photography and film. Whether you are shooting a portrait, a product, or a scene in a movie, the ability to manipulate light effectively can make all the difference.Moreover, light booms are particularly useful in situations where space is limited. In small studios or tight outdoor locations, traditional lighting setups may not be feasible. However, with a light boom, you can elevate your lights above the scene, freeing up valuable floor space while still achieving excellent illumination. This adaptability makes them a favorite among professionals and amateurs alike.Another significant advantage of using light booms is the ability to create a three-dimensional effect in your images. By positioning lights at different heights and angles, you can enhance depth and dimension, making your subjects appear more lifelike. This technique is particularly effective in portrait photography, where capturing the nuances of a person's features is crucial. A well-placed light can accentuate cheekbones, create catchlights in the eyes, and add warmth to skin tones.Additionally, light booms allow for greater experimentation with colors and filters. By placing colored gels on your lights, you can transform the ambiance of a scene dramatically. This versatility is especially beneficial for filmmakers who want to evoke specific emotions or themes within their work. For example, a warm orange hue can create a cozy, intimate atmosphere, while cooler tones can convey a sense of detachment or melancholy.However, it is essential to understand that using light booms effectively requires practice and knowledge of lighting principles. Beginners may find it challenging to achieve the right balance of light and shadow, but with time and experience, they can master the art of lighting. Many professionals recommend starting with basic setups and gradually experimenting with more complex arrangements as one becomes comfortable with the equipment.In conclusion, light booms are invaluable tools in the realm of photography and videography. They offer flexibility, creativity, and the ability to produce stunning visual effects. Understanding how to utilize light booms can significantly enhance the quality of your work, allowing you to tell stories and convey emotions through the power of light. As technology continues to advance, the potential for innovation in lighting techniques will only grow, making it an exciting time for creatives in this field.
